About The Position

Are you passionate about making a difference in people's lives? Do you enjoy working in a service-oriented industry? If so, this opportunity may be the right fit for you! Modivcare is looking for an experienced Senior React Native Engineer to join our team. In this role, you will be responsible for the design, development, and support of new software applications. You will work closely with business stakeholders and IT support staff to implement software solutions, document requirements, and ensure the final product meets user needs. This role… Leads all stages of the software development lifecycle, including design meetings, data layouts, implementation, testing, deployment, and maintenance. Architects software solutions and prepares functional and design documentation, including user requirements, unit test plans, and user documentation. Participates in code reviews, conducts unit and functional testing, and partners with QA to resolve bugs. Develops new software using various programming and scripting languages, business process toolsets, and data modeling/reporting tools. Maintains and enhances business applications in both client-server and web-based environments. Collaborates with stakeholders to set policies for coding, review, and design. Provides technical expertise to support teams in resolving customer issues. Works within an agile development methodology and performs the role of scrum master. Identifies and resolves software performance issues. Delivers product demonstrations to leadership and stakeholders. Conducts periodic technology overview and training sessions. May lead projects and perform other duties as assigned. Occasional business travel may be required.

Requirements

  • Bachelor's Degree in Computer Science, MIS, or related technical field required.
  • Seven (7) plus years of related industry experience required.
  • Expert in React Native with a proven track record of building and maintaining mobile applications for both iOS and Android.
  • Proficient in React and familiar with AI-assisted development tools and workflows (preferred).
  • Strong familiarity with backend services, REST APIs, and AWS cloud infrastructure.
  • Experience with CI/CD pipelines, source control (Git), and branching strategies.
  • Solid understanding of testing frameworks, test-driven development, and automated QA practices.
  • Knowledge of performance monitoring, mobile analytics, and observability tools.
  • Strong problem-solving and analytical capabilities.
  • Effective verbal and written communication skills.
  • Demonstrated success collaborating across departments.
  • High responsiveness to evolving business needs.
  • Recognized as a subject matter expert on software tools and release processes.

Nice To Haves

  • Previous experience in the healthcare or insurance industry preferred.
  • Exposure to HIPAA compliance, secure data exchange, and healthcare interoperability.
  • Proficient in enterprise relational databases (MS SQL Server, Oracle, or DB2).
  • Strong familiarity with UI technologies including HTML, CSS, JavaScript, TypeScript.
  • Strong familiarity with Figma UX/UI design tool.

Responsibilities

  • Leads all stages of the software development lifecycle, including design meetings, data layouts, implementation, testing, deployment, and maintenance.
  • Architects software solutions and prepares functional and design documentation, including user requirements, unit test plans, and user documentation.
  • Participates in code reviews, conducts unit and functional testing, and partners with QA to resolve bugs.
  • Develops new software using various programming and scripting languages, business process toolsets, and data modeling/reporting tools.
  • Maintains and enhances business applications in both client-server and web-based environments.
  • Collaborates with stakeholders to set policies for coding, review, and design.
  • Provides technical expertise to support teams in resolving customer issues.
  • Works within an agile development methodology and performs the role of scrum master.
  • Identifies and resolves software performance issues.
  • Delivers product demonstrations to leadership and stakeholders.
  • Conducts periodic technology overview and training sessions.
  • May lead projects and perform other duties as assigned.

Benefits

  • Medical, Dental, and Vision insurance
  • Employer Paid Basic Life Insurance and AD&D
  • Voluntary Life Insurance (Employee/Spouse/Child)
  • Health Care and Dependent Care Flexible Spending Accounts
  • Pre-Tax and Post --Tax Commuter and Parking Benefits
  • 401(k) Retirement Savings Plan with Company Match
  • Paid Time Off
  • Paid Parental Leave
  • Short-Term and Long-Term Disability
  • Tuition Reimbursement
  • Employee Discounts (retail, hotel, food, restaurants, car rental and much more!)
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service